The Dawn of Your Culinary Empire: Understanding the Challenges

In every journey of creation, understanding the terrain is crucial. Starting a food business is no different; it's akin to embarking on a quest where passion meets pragmatism. The first hurdle often comes in the form of capital investment. It's not just about having enough money; it's about smart allocation towards equipment, ingredients, and perhaps most importantly, location. This challenge requires you to think differently, seeing beyond mere costs to envision potential returns.

Then there's the reality of competition. The food industry is saturated with hopeful entrepreneurs aiming for their slice of success. To stand out, one must not only offer something unique but also ensure consistent quality and experience. It's about creating a story around your brand that resonates with your audience, making them come back for more. This requires an innovative mindset, one that challenges the status quo and seeks to redefine standards.

Navigating Legalities: More Than Just Red Tape

The path of innovation often leads us through intricate landscapes of rules and regulations. In the food business, navigating legalities is not just about compliance; it's an art form. It's understanding that these laws are there not as barriers but as guidelines designed to protect both you and your patrons. From health inspections to licensing, each step offers an opportunity to solidify the trustworthiness of your brand. See this process as refining your vision, ensuring that every detail aligns with the highest standards.

Equally important is the protection of your intellectual property - your recipes, branding, and unique concepts. In a world where ideas flow freely, securing what makes yours distinctive is critical. This doesn't mean shrouding everything in secrecy but knowing what to protect and how. Approach this with clarity and precision, seeing it as laying down the foundations upon which your culinary empire will stand strong against competition. It's about safeguarding your vision as much as executing it.
